How Could She?
In "How Could She?" by Dana Fowley, readers are taken on a harrowing journey through the eyes of a brave survivor. At just five years old, Dana discovers the harsh reality of betrayal when she and her younger sister become victims of one of Britain's most notorious paedophile rings. With no one to turn to for help, including a mother who failed to protect them, Dana's childhood is marked by fear and suffering. Now, in this compelling memoir published by Cornerstone in 2010, Dana shares her story of resilience and determination as she fights to bring her abusers to justice. Spanning 304 pages, "How Could She?" is not just a tale of survival but also a powerful testament to the strength of the human spirit.
